Product Rating: 2 BE AWARE!!
Reviewer: Cara Boutcolor   Thu Jan 08 2009

ANY "HENNA" that can make colors other than red/auburn.. is not PURE henna. It's a compound dye & will react adversely if you have any other permanent color on your hair!
If you have virgin hair, go ahead & try. If your hair is previously colored, it will turn scary colors or even melt your hair away. (metallic reactions)
Don't get me wrong, I love pure henna.
Just remember this when comtemplating products such as these... they may or may not be bad.. but ALWAYS bad with previous permanent color!!

Here is how I put mine on:

Warning, it looks green, don't be alarmed it will not turn your hair green.

1. I heat up about 3 cups of water in the microwave.
2. Put the powder in a ceramic bowl and mix the water with it using a plastic spoon until it is well blended.
3. I test the mix with my bare finger just to see if it is warm.
4. I usually do this all with bare hands but I do recommend gloves for most people.
5. I make sure I distribute it evenly all the way to my ends, my hair is about 3 inches past my shoulders.
6. Then I pile the hair on top of my head and cover with a plastic cap. You can get these online or at any beauty supply store.
7. After I civer with the plastic cap I get in the shower and careful not to wet my head I rinse off any henna that is on my skin.
8. Dry off using an old towel.
9. Put a wool winter hat on my head over the plastic cap to produce some heat.
10. I usually leave it on for about 3 hours but you might not have to leave it in that long or you can leave it in as long as overnight. It won't harm your hair or scalp.
11. I rinse it out in the shower and usually use Suave conditioner on it about 3-4 times just to make sure I get all the grit out, this works very well for me.

One thing to make note of, Red Henna is an astringent which means it will tighten the skin on your scalp while it is in your hair. This is nothing to be alarmed about but it does account for some people saying they had a "burning" sensation. Witch hazel is a more common astringent and it cause the same reaction on the skin. It isn't a chemical reaction in the sense of regular conventional hairdyes and will not harm you or your hair.
